Hernando police officer to undergo surgery after slipping while helping driver stuck on ice
HERNANDO, Miss. (WMC) - A Hernando police officer is expected to undergo surgery after he reportedly slipped while assisting a driver stuck on an icy road Friday afternoon.
The entire Mid-South has been burdened by dangerous driving conditions due to snow, ice, and sub-freezing temperatures that have persisted for several days.
According to Chief Shane Ellis with the Hernando Police Department, the officer was helping a driver who became stuck on McIngvale Road near the Magnolias at Hernando Apartments around 4 p.m. Friday when he slipped on the ice and injured his leg.
The officer, who has not been identified, was transported to Regional One Hospital in Memphis for treatment.
He is expected to undergo surgery on his leg due to the nature of his injuries.
Temperatures are expected to remain below freezing until Sunday.
Drivers are advised to avoid travel unless absolutely necessary.
